1// SPDX-License-Identifier: GPL-2.0+2 3/*4 * Quirks for I2C-HID devices that do not supply proper descriptors5 *6 * Copyright (c) 2018 Julian Sax <jsbc@gmx.de>7 *8 */9 10#include <linux/types.h>11#include <linux/dmi.h>12#include <linux/mod_devicetable.h>13#include <linux/hid.h>14 15#include "i2c-hid.h"16#include "../hid-ids.h"17 18 19struct i2c_hid_desc_override {20 union {21 struct i2c_hid_desc *i2c_hid_desc;22 uint8_t *i2c_hid_desc_buffer;23 };24 uint8_t *hid_report_desc;25 unsigned int hid_report_desc_size;26 uint8_t *i2c_name;27};28 29 30/*31 * descriptors for the SIPODEV SP1064 touchpad32 *33 * This device does not supply any descriptors and on windows a filter34 * driver operates between the i2c-hid layer and the device and injects35 * these descriptors when the device is prompted. The descriptors were36 * extracted by listening to the i2c-hid traffic that occurs between the37 * windows filter driver and the windows i2c-hid driver.38 */39 40static const struct
